The Four Elements as a Diagnostic Framework

At the heart of elemental-esthetics is the belief that every person has a unique elemental constitution. Just as the four elements interact in nature, they also interact within us. A client with a dominant "earth" constitution may struggle with sluggishness, congestion, or a need for grounding treatments. A "fire" type might experience inflammation, sensitivity, or redness. "Water" types often deal with puffiness, dehydration, or emotional sensitivity, while "air" types may present with dryness, fine lines, or a tendency toward anxiety. By assessing these elemental imbalances, an esthetician can create a truly personalized plan that addresses the root cause of skin concerns, not just the symptoms.

Product Selection and Ingredient Synergy

Choosing the right products is critical in elemental-esthetics. Ingredients are selected not just for their efficacy but for their energetic properties. For example, clay and root extracts are associated with the earth element and are excellent for grounding and detoxifying. Rose and cucumber resonate with water, offering hydration and soothing qualities. Spicy ingredients like ginger and cinnamon align with fire, stimulating circulation and renewal. Light, airy botanicals like chamomile and lavender connect to the air element, promoting calm and clarity. This thoughtful curation elevates the client’s experience from a simple service to a sensory journey.

Step 2: Redesign Your Consultation Process

Your initial consultation is the foundation of the elemental-esthetics experience. Create a detailed intake form that goes beyond typical skin concerns. Ask questions about energy levels, sleep patterns, stress triggers, dietary habits, and emotional tendencies. You can also incorporate a visual assessment, observing the skin’s texture, tone, and reactivity. Based on this information, you can determine the client’s dominant elemental type and any imbalances. This structured approach not only provides valuable data but also makes the client feel like a partner in their own wellness journey.
